Tested in [desktop] Safari 13.1.2 (an up-to-date version), the following worked:
  • jsatom;
  • Tiny Emulators;
  • virtualkc;
  • Elk JS; and
  • JSBeeb.
So, assuming I didn't miss any, only HTeMuLator failed. It worked in Firefox so I'm pretty sure Safari is the relevant factor.
